What Happens When You're Dead

When a player ends up unfortunately gripped by the ghost during the Hunting Phase in Phasmophobia, it's game over for them... for the most part. All their items will be dropped on the floor, making them free game for other players to use. Then, they will be condemned to wander the afterlife.

While dead, the player will be able to roam the map still and observe other players through a white-tinted fog. However, they will not be able to communicate with the living players even though they can still hear them. They can make their presence known by picking up and throwing items from the location, such as kitchen utensils and teddy bears.

When a player dies in Phasmophobia, not all is lost. They can still be a key component in assisting, or messing with, living players. If players are using a third-party programme, such as Discord, the dead player can communicate with the other players to help them, given that they can now see much further and still find evidence. They just can't interact with it.

Below, we have listed a handful of things that dead players can do:

  • Mess with the remaining players - They can pick up items from around the map, such as plates or knives, and throw them around to make the living players believe something ghostly is happening. Alternatively, dead players can also trigger any Motion Sensors placed around the map.
  • Finish filling out the Journal - If the ghost type is discovered or the dead player has a suspicion of the type, they can still fill out their Journal with whichever type of ghost they think killed them. If they're correct, they will still get a reward for this. This, and messing with remaining players, is about all a dead player can do without Discord or a similar programme.
  • Find extra evidence - This requires a programme like Discord to let the remaining players know. While dead, a player can still see Bone Evidence, Ghost Writing and Dirty Water in sinks. If they find this, they can let fellow players know so that they can snap a picture of it.
  • Help players avoid the ghost - The ghost will obviously not target or interact with the dead player, but they can still see it. With this in mind and with the help of Discord, the dead player can help living players to evade the ghost by observing it during its Hunting Phase and pointing out where they should run or hide.
